- BBK_stock_price_manipulation_incident comment "During the 2007 presidential election, questions about presidential candidate Lee Myung-bak's relationship with a company called BBK were raised. In 1999, Lee met BBK co-founder Kim Kyung-joon (also known as Christopher Kim) and established the LKE Bank with Kim Kyung-joon. However, this enterprise went bankrupt less than a year later and 5,500 investors lost substantial amounts of money. Kim Kyung-joon was investigated for large-scale embezzlement and stock price-fixing schemes.".
